Description from the owner
Overlooking a dramatic bluff, 'Keiha's Paradise' offers wonderful views of the spectacular Pacific Ocean. Enjoy this dazzling vista through large windows while indoors or step out onto the living room lanai and watch for dolphins and whales offshore as you relax or dine.
Off the master bedroom is a second lanai, which presents you with a wondrous landscape of mountains and waterfalls, and is a great spot to curl up with a good book. Or simply enjoy this lush vista from the comfort of your king-size bed.

The Cliffs at Princeville is a 22 acre property located on a bluff overlooking the Pacific Ocean. The complex is a mix of owner and timeshare offered condo rental units. The Cliffs were originally built in the early 1980s. The complex recently underwent an 8 million dollar restoration, completed in 2001. Overall the complex is in really good shape, only needing the normal wear and tear maintenance here and there as anybody would expect in such a harsh, sea salt environment.
